The purpose of representations and warranties in the Ohio Bill of Sale of Automobile or Car with Disclaimer of Warranties is to clarify the condition and history of the vehicle. These statements serve to inform both the buyer and seller about critical aspects like ownership and whether any claims exist against the car. By outlining these points, the document helps reduce misunderstandings and potential disputes. Therefore, having clear reps and warranties can protect both parties involved.

No, Ohio does not require a notarized bill of sale for a vehicle transfer. However, having a notarized Ohio Bill of Sale of Automobile or Car with Disclaimer of Warranties can provide added security and protection for both parties involved. Notarization may serve as a way to verify the identities of those signing the document. While Ohio does not legally require a bill of sale for every vehicle sale, having one is highly recommended. A bill of sale provides proof of the transaction and can simplify the registration process. A standard bill of sale simply transfers ownership of the vehicle from the seller to the buyer. In contrast, a warranty bill of sale provides additional protection by including guarantees about the vehicle's condition and legal ownership. A title warranty clause in a sales contract ensures that the seller guarantees the buyer clear ownership of the vehicle. This means the seller confirms they have the legal right to sell the automobile or car without any liens or encumbrances. In the state of Ohio when you sell or buy a vehicle, complete a Bill of Sale Form though it is not required. This serves as a legal contract from the seller to the buyer documenting the change in ownership and the purchase price.

To transfer a car title in Ohio, the seller needs to transfer the title to the buyer with a notarized signature. The buyer will also need to fill out a title application and possibly an odometer disclosure.
